Surging interest in India papers gives a boost to Re-Eurobond issuances

According to data provided by UAE-based Cbonds, the total aggregate issuance of rupee eurobonds was at $2.54 billion in the first four months 2024, higher than $2 billion for the whole of 2023. Eurobonds are securities denominated in currencies that are different from the national currencies of the countries in which issuance takes place.
